3. The Dance of the Tunnel Book - Smithsonian Libraries
Tunnel books or peep shows are a series of cut-paper panels placed one behind the other, creating the illusion of depth and perspective.
Tunnel books or peep shows are a series of cut-paper panels placed one behind the other, creating the illusion of depth and perspective. Often, these are engineered like an accordion, with the two boards pulling apart and the illustrated panels lined up and viewed through a front peep-hole or viewer.
